Core i7-6950X vs Xeon E-2176M benchmarks
In our benchmarks, the Core i7-6950X beats the Xeon E-2176M in overall performance. Despite this, the Xeon E-2176M has the advantage in our gaming benchmark.
In terms of the number of cores of each of these CPUs, the Core i7-6950X has significantly more cores than the Xeon E-2176M. Indeed, the Core i7-6950X has 10 cores compared to 6 cores found in the Xeon E-2176M. It also has more threads than the Xeon E-2176M. These CPUs have different clock speeds. Indeed, the Core i7-6950X has a slightly higher clock speed compared to the Xeon E-2176M. Despite this, the Xeon E-2176M has a slightly higher turbo speed. The Xeon E-2176M outputs less heat than Core i7-6950X thanks to a significantly lower TDP. This measures the amount of heat they output and can be used to estimate power consumption.
Most CPUs have more threads than cores. This technology, colloquially called hyperthreading, improves performance by splitting a core into multiple virtual ones. This provides more efficient utilisation of a core. Indeed, the Core i7-6950X has more threads than cores. Each physical core is split into multiple threads.
